Well Ottos are the only 100% safe. If you have a big community tank you could do well with Neos with all kinds of fish if you give them enough cover via plants and hidding spaces. I have a thrive group of PFR culls in a 55g community tank with a pair of GBR a shoal of 15 rummy nosed tetras and 4 small discus
